Turkey to take its own troop decision whereas India

After meeting, Erdogan stated that any decision of the UN would be welcomed and needed, but on the other hand Turkish delegations’ observations had been continuing in Iraq and so under the frame of reports coming from the region, Turkey would make its decision clear on the issue of sending troops to Iraq.

In addition to this, Erdogan underlined that Turkish special forces wouldn’t defend only one minority group in Iraq, but Turkey would be there for welfare of whole Iraqi people.

Indian Prime Minister also stressed that New Delhi would wait for UN decision and after it they could also send soldiers to Baghdad.

About terrorism, Erdogan said that an international struggle needed for terrorism and it had no religion, race. So both Turkey and India signed a deal on terrorism.
